Nic usually looks pretty good against PG's. Even when they get around him, they know he's got those long arms and an open jumper or pass is always at risk of getting tipped from behind. It's the stronger swingmen that give him fits. He's an above average defender against quickness and a below average defender against strength, which washes him out as a pretty mediocre defender overall.

Lillard showed some pretty nice post defense in the preseason. Damian was so bad at defense last year that I can see why the coach didn't try having him guard a different position that often. But if he can not get posted up too badly while guarding 2's and even some 3's, it could be huge for Portland to have Batum focus on PG's.
